摘要
Room temperature lasing has been achieved in vertical-cavity surface-emitting laser structures for wavelengths as short as 699 nm under pulsed electrical excitation. The molecular beam epitaxially grown structures have p- and n-type semiconductor quarter wave mirror stacks enclosing an active region containing a short period GaAs-AlAs superlattice.
